H. Machali et Ma. Madkour, RADIATIVE-TRANSFER IN A PARTICIPATING SLAB WITH ANISOTROPIC SCATTERING AND GENERAL BOUNDARY-CONDITIONS, Journal of quantitative spectroscopy & radiative transfer, 54(5), 1995, pp. 803-813
Radiative transfer has been considered within a participating plane sl
ab bounded by two emitting and reflecting plates. The slab is assumed
in radiative equilibrium and scatter radiation anisotropically. The sc
attering function is expanded into Legendre polynomials and a rigorous
solution is developed based on the projection method. The resulting f
ormulae for the partial and total heat fluxes have been numerically pr
ocessed, for both linearly anisotropic and Rayleigh modes of scatterin
g. For the isotropically scattering case, the computed values complete
ly reproduce those available in the literature. As regards to the anis
otropic results it has the same accuracy like that for isotropic.
